About Wycallis Primary Center

Wycallis Primary Center serves 526 students in kindergarten through second grade in Dallas, Pennsylvania, providing a strong educational foundation during these crucial early learning years. With 32 full-time teachers maintaining a 16.4:1 student-teacher ratio, the school offers personalized attention that helps young learners develop essential skills. The school demonstrates impressive academic performance, earning a 7.6 out of 10 rating from MySchoolScout and ranking in the 83rd percentile among Pennsylvania elementary schools at #480 out of 2,852 statewide.

Students show strong proficiency in core subjects, with 78% achieving proficient or above levels in English Language Arts and reading, while 71% meet or exceed proficiency standards in mathematics. These results reflect the school's commitment to building solid academic foundations in literacy and numeracy. Wycallis Primary Center draws families from a well-established suburban community where the median household income reaches $95,932 and 37% of residents hold bachelor's degrees or higher.

The neighborhood's stability, with a low 9.5% poverty rate and median home values around $241,500, creates a supportive environment for educational achievement. Located in the large suburban area of Dallas, Pennsylvania, the school serves as an integral part of this thriving Luzerne County community.

Community Profile

The community surrounding Wycallis Primary Center has a median household income of $97,022. It is an area where 37%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$250,700, with a median rent of $1,150/month. The local poverty rate of 9.6% is relatively low. The average commute for residents is 28 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
